"Run on my mark! I'll cover you!" Blasts of blue energy came at them rapidly as they squished their bodies together against a large pillar, wincing at every bullet that passed them. Steve readied himself to sprint to the exit. Elenara gripped Xiuh in her palm and peeked her head out as a few began to reload their ammunition.

"Now!"

Steve launched himself through the opening, towards the door at the end of the facility. Elenara spun her staff as fast as she could, the beams of energy reflected off it and aimed back at them. Hydra agents immediately stopped firing and jumped for cover. Her turquoise eyes widened as she saw a man disintegrate from thin air.

That's what it does? Erase men from with a single touch? That energy wasn't made by humans. How did they get a power such as that?

"C'mon!" His call for her broke her from her thoughts. Beads of sweat gleamed on her forehead and strands of hair flew from her braid. She forced her legs to charge forwards before they fired another round of energy. Side by side they ran towards the end of the facility fighting off any Hydra agents that came their way.

Bucky was alive. He just had to be.

≫──────≪•◦ ☼ ◦•≫──────≪

As they walked down a narrow hall to catch their breath, they caught a man run away in fear. The pair shared a look before dashing down the hall.

"He's gone." Steve said incredulously. How far could he have gotten? A groan caught her ear and she pulled on his arm in the room he fled from.

"Sergeant. Three-two-five-five-seven."

"Jimmy!" Tears of happiness fell from her eyes as Bucky lay on a table as a green light hit his skin.

"Bucky!" His eyes almost seemed lifeless, like as if he was in a trance of sorts. Steve caught the straps that held him down, pained to even think what they were doing to him.

"Oh, my God." They ripped off the leather straps with ease. The tight sensation from his wrists and legs went away and he exhaled in relief. The light in his eyes returned and was removed from his trance.

"Is that. . ." Bucky saw Steve, only he was bigger and muscular. He squinted his eyes, expecting for his small frame to return, but he stayed the same.

"It's me." Steve exhaled in relief.

"It's Steve." Bucky's eyes wandered to the silhouette next to him. "Elenara?" A sudden blush overcame his pale cheeks as memories of their last encounter flashed in his head.
